The Azerbaijani men's chess team could become European champions for the fourth time in its history today.
According to "Report", the team consisting of Shakhriyar Mamedyarov, Rauf Mammadov, Aydin Suleymanli, Mahammad Muradli, and Eltaj Safarli will face Serbia in the 9th round of the continental championship held in Batumi, Georgia.
After 8 rounds, the team shares the lead with the Ukrainian national team with 13 points. If the team wins the last round, it can secure its fourth championship.
It is worth recalling that the Azerbaijani men's national team became European champions in 2009, 2013 and 2017.
The women's team will meet with Poland today. The team, which includes Ulviyya Fataliyeva, Govhar Beydullayeva, Gulnar Mammadova, Khanim Balajayeva and Ayan Allahverdiyeva, is sixth with 10 points. The team has lost its chance to win a medal.
